Photo of the Rosette Nebula by John Reed

Posted on October 23, 2022November 5, 2022 By pocatelloastro
Photos

This stunning photo of the Rosette Nebula is brought to you by club president John Reed. This beautiful HII region located in the constellation of Monoceros is a gem of the winter sky. Located about 5200 lightyears from earth contains many O-type stars as well as young new stars. Taken with Meade 70mm f5 Quad and ASI2600MM camera.
